Journal of Composite Materials | 1995

Notched Strength and Fracture Criterion in Fabric Composite Plates Containing a Circular Hole

Jung-Kyu Kim; Do-Sik Kim; Nobuo Takeda

The effects of the hole size and the specimen width on the fracture behavior of several woven fabric composite plates are experimentally investigated in tension. It is shown in this paper that the characteristic length (d o ) in the Point Stress Criterion (PSC) depends on the hole size and the specimen width. A modified PSC for predicting the notched strength is proposed. An excellent agreement is found between the experimental results and the analytical predictions using the modified PSC. When the unstable fracture occurred, the equivalent critical crack length (a c ) corresponding to the damage zone size is about twice the characteristic length. The characteristic length decreases with an increase in the notched strength. The critical energy release rate (G c ) corresponding to the unstable fracture criterion is independent of the hole size for the same specimen width. G c increases with an increase in the specimen width. These results can be explained by the correlation between the G c and the notch sensitivity factor (k).


Transactions of The Korean Society of Mechanical Engineers A | 2010

Lifetime Estimation of an Axle Drive Shaft by Calibrated Accelerated Life Test Method

Do-Sik Kim; Hyoung-Eui Kim; Sung-Han Yoon; E-Sok Kang

In this paper, a method to predict the fatigue life of an axle drive shaft by the calibrated accelerated life test (CALT) method is proposed. The CALT method is very effective for predicting lifetimes, significantly reducing test time, and quantifying reliability. The fatigue test is performed by considering two high stress and one low stress levels, and the lifetime at the normal stress level is predicted by extrapolation. In addition, in this study, the major reliability parameters such as the lifetime, accelerated power index, shape parameter, and scale parameter are determined by conducting various experiments. The lifetime prediction of the axle drive shaft is verified by comparing the experimental results with load spectrum data. The results confirm that the CALT method is effective for lifetime prediction and requires a short test time.


ASME 2003 International Mechanical Engineering Congress and Exposition | 2003

Study of the Accelerated Life Test Method for Power Train Components Under Cyclic Loads Using Weibull-IPL (Inverse Power Law) Model

Geunho Lee; Hyoung-Eui Kim; Do-Sik Kim

This study was performed to develop the accelerated life test method using Weibull-IPL (Inverse Power Law) model for power train components that are running on cyclic loads. Weibull-IPL model is concerned with determining the assurance life with confidence level and the accelerated life test time. From the relation of weibull distribution factors and confidence limit, the testing times on the no or some number of failure acceptance criteria are determined. The power train components under cyclic loads generally represent wear and fatigue characteristics as a failure mode. IPL based on the cumulative damage theory is applied effectively the mechanical components to reduce the testing time and to achieve the accelerating test conditions. The proposed Weibull-IPL model is an approach to improve the reliability assessment on the statistical distribution and wear out failure mechanism concepts. As the actual application example, accelerated life test method of agricultural tractor transmission was described. Life distribution of agricultural tractor transmission was supposed to follow Weibull distribution and life test time was calculated under the conditions of average life (MTBF) 3,000 hours and 90% confidence level for one test sample. According to IPL, because test time can be shorten in case increase test load, test time could be reduced by 482 hours when we put the load 1.1 times of rated load than 0.73 times of rated load that is equivalent load calculated by load spectrum of the agricultural tractor. This time, acceleration factor was 11.7. This Weibull-IPL model can be used to develop accelerated test method of gear reducer, hydraulic hose, bearing and etc.Copyright

Transactions of The Korean Society of Mechanical Engineers A | 2015

Development of the Accelerated Life Test Method & Life Test Equipment for the Counterweight of the Construction Machinery

Gi-Chun Lee; Young-Bum Lee; Byung-Oh Choi; Bo-Sik Kang; Do-Sik Kim; Jong-Sik Choi; Jaehoon Kim

A large-sized exciter that vibrates a two-ton component is required to simulate the field operating conditions of a counterweight of an excavator. However, it is difficult for a small-medium sized company to obtain a large exciter for the life test of a counterweight which is an equivalent counterbalancing weight that balances a load. Therefore, in this study, we developed life test equipment for evaluating the reliability of construction machinery weighing about two tons. It simulates the field operating conditions using rotational vibrators consisting of electric motors. A failure analysis of the counterweight was also performed for the major components. Field data acquired from various sites were applied to the life test design of the counterweight. Finally, a zero-failure qualification test based on the accelerated life test was designed, and there was no failure during the test, which guarantees a life of 10,000 hours.


Transactions of The Korean Society of Mechanical Engineers A | 2015

Reliability Evaluation of Concentric Butterfly Valve Using Statistical Hypothesis Test

Mu-Seong Chang; Jong-Sik Choi; Byung-Oh Choi; Do-Sik Kim

A butterfly valve is a type of flow-control device typically used to regulate a fluid flow. This paper presents an estimation of the shape parameter of the Weibull distribution, characteristic life, and life for a concentric butterfly valve based on a statistical analysis of the reliability test data taken before and after the valve improvement. The difference in the shape and scale parameters between the existing and improved valves is reviewed using a statistical hypothesis test. The test results indicate that the shape parameter of the improved valve is similar to that of the existing valve, and that the scale parameter of the improved valve is found to have increased. These analysis results are particularly useful for a reliability qualification test and the determination of the service life cycles.

Transactions of The Korean Society of Mechanical Engineers A | 2000

Low Temperature Effects on the Strength and Fracture Toughness of Membrane for LNG Storage Tank

Jeong-Gyu Kim; Cheol-Su Kim; Dong-Hyeok Jo; Do-Sik Kim; In-Su Yun

Tensile and fracture toughness tests of the cold-rolled STS 304 steel plate for membrane material of LNG storage tank were performed at wide range of temperatures, 11 IK(boiling point of LNG), 153K , 193K and 293K(room temperature). Tensile strength significantly increases with a decrease in temperature, but the yield strength is relatively insensitive to temperature. Elongation at 193K abruptly decreases by 50% of that at 293K, and then decreases slightly in the temperature range of 193K to 111K. Strain hardening exponents at low temperatures are about four times as high as that at 293K. Elastic-plastic fracture toughness() and tearing modulus() tend to decrease with a decrease in temperature. The values are inversely related to effective yield strength in the temperature range of 111K to 293K. These phenomena result from a significant increase in the amount of transformed martensite in low temperature regions.
